There are many places where it can be used. Chongqing Bidirectional Plastic Geogrid These include basic reinforcement, retaining wall construction—such as single-panel stabilization and segmental techniques—along with Great Wall-style elements, embankment reinforcement, and pile cap platforms. Chongqing Bidirectional Plastic Geogrid Primarily used in foundation reinforcement applications, while uniaxial geogrids are typically employed elsewhere. Here, the focus will be solely on the base. Chongqing Bidirectional Plastic Geogrid Reinforced with ribs.

Chongqing Bidirectional Plastic Geogrid Placed alongside granular or interlocking work soil materials. The holes allow impact on the covering soil material, which then interlocks with the ribs (flat straps/stripes), providing a stabilizing constraint for the covering particles/soil due to the rigidity and strength of the ribs.

Chongqing Bidirectional Plastic Geogrid The engineering function:

1. Chongqing Bidirectional Plastic Geogrid Highly durable, with minimal creep, and adaptable to various soil conditions—this material perfectly meets the demands of tall retaining walls used in high-grade highways.

2, Chongqing Bidirectional Plastic Geogrid It effectively enhances the interlocking and interlocking action of the reinforced bearing surface, significantly boosting the foundation's load-bearing capacity while providing excellent restraint against lateral soil movement, thereby strengthening the overall stability of the foundation.

3, Chongqing Bidirectional Plastic Geogrid Compared to traditional gratings, it boasts enhanced strength, superior load-bearing capacity, excellent corrosion resistance, a high coefficient of friction, uniform perforation, ease of installation, and an exceptionally long service life.

4. Chongqing Bidirectional Plastic Geogrid Adapted for deep-sea operations and shoreline reinforcement, it fundamentally addresses the technical challenges—such as low strength, poor corrosion resistance, and short service life—that arise when using alternative materials for gabions due to prolonged exposure to seawater erosion.

5, Chongqing Bidirectional Plastic Geogrid It can effectively prevent construction damage caused by equipment crushing or destruction during the construction process.

Geotube: A sludge dewatering tool—your eco-friendly engineering ally

A geotube is a tubular bag made by sewing together high-strength geotextile fabric. Utilizing the natural principle of gravity filtration, it removes water from sludge, effectively separating mud from water.
